READING COPY ONLY This is Professor Hoffmann's third book of illusions (following 'Modern Magic' & 'More Magic'), and whilst the text block appears complete, the lack of spine cloth means this copy is for the practitioner (and hopefully the binder first). Hoffmann starts here with the conjurer's special clothing, appliances, table and wand, and then works through a series of 'vanishes' (watches, rings, handkerchiefs), building to more sophisticated routines - all with patter (and amply illustrated).
